...FLOOD WATCH IN EFFECT THROUGH WEDNESDAY EVENING...

* WHAT...Flooding caused by excessive rainfall continues to be
possible.

* WHERE...Portions of northern Connecticut, including the following
area, Windham CT, central Massachusetts, including the following
areas, Northern Worcester MA and Southern Worcester MA, and
northern Rhode Island, including the following areas, Northwest
Providence RI and Southeast Providence RI.

* WHEN...Through Wednesday evening.

* IMPACTS...Excessive runoff may result in flooding of rivers,
creeks, streams, and other low-lying and flood-prone locations.
Flooding may occur in poor drainage and urban areas.

* ADDITIONAL DETAILS...
- Moderate to heavy rainfall is expected to develop Tuesday
afternoon into Wednesday across the Watch area. The heaviest
rainfall is expected Tuesday evening into Wednesday.
Excessive rainfall rates are possible, which could trigger
instances of street flooding and contribute to rises on
rivers, streams and larger river basins. Two to four inches
of rain are expected in the Watch area, with locally higher
amounts possible especially along the eastern slopes of the
Worcester Hills.
